# Approvals: Monthly Partitioning on Ledgerline

All partition-rotation changes to the Ledgerline events tables require prior approval. The rotation job creates next month's partition on the 25th and detaches partitions older than 13 months. If the job fails, do not manually create partitions without sign-off; mismatched bounds have corrupted Harbrook replica syncs before. On-call engineers should file an approval request in the Pellwright queue and wait for confirmation. The approver of record is listed below.

account owner for bawip-tahag: Raleth Quenok

Handover — audit-log viewer (Ledgerlens)

Picking up from me: Ledgerlens is stable, but the retention job sometimes stalls past 2M rows — restart the worker, don't touch the index. Dashboards live under the ops board. Export requests from compliance go through the queue, not manually. If the viewer's encrypted archive store locks during an incident, unlock it with the recovery passphrase below.

strongbox words: prawyn-fenmir

## Pilot: Granbury Retail Chain (Managers Only)

Pilot with Granbury Stores starts in four locations next month. Scope: shelf analytics via our Ovenbird sensors. Duration: twelve weeks. Success metric: 8% shrinkage reduction. Contacts on their side sit with Tilda Marsh's team. Do not discuss externally; Granbury's board hasn't announced. Hardware ships week one; training week two. The confidential portion of the plan is noted below.

board note of kafog-bajep: Briathek Partners is in early talks to buy Aldaelek Group for about $47.1 million. The Ulaath launch date is September 4, and nothing goes to the press before then.

Subject: Partner SFTP drop — new owner

Hi,

As you review the pending changes to the Harborline ingest scripts, note that ownership of the partner SFTP drop is changing at the end of the month. This includes key rotation, the nightly pull job, and the quarantine folder for malformed files. Review comments on the retry logic should still go through the normal PR flow, but questions about drop-folder conventions or partner onboarding now go to the new owner. The incoming owner is listed below.

signatory, tagaf-bahaf: Praael Fenmir Rusok